Output 6861594e3e3d2475679814e01c5400889ecee4cfd1b3b22eba65d34d8e44135a:6

value
52778932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4edbda7a159f33f8418690879b2c6363e52f2ad2 OP_EQUAL
address
MF68K5QTb2QSwzKxWwQXaXGsvJhjtjDRbR
transaction
6861594e3e3d2475679814e01c5400889ecee4cfd1b3b22eba65d34d8e44135a
spent
true